After a morning at the beach, head to the UNESCO World Heritage Site, the Basilica of Bom Jesus. Admire the stunning Baroque architecture and visit the tomb of St. Francis Xavier, a revered Catholic saint. Take a moment to appreciate the intricate artworks and carvings inside the basilica. (Free admission, 1 hour)
Embark on a guided tour to one of Goa's spice plantations. Learn about the various spices grown in the region, such as cardamom, black pepper, and cinnamon. Take a walk through the lush green plantations, taste aromatic spices, and enjoy a traditional Goan lunch served on banana leaves. (Approximate cost: INR 700 per person, 2 hours)
Experience the mesmerizing Dudhsagar Falls, one of the tallest waterfalls in India. Enjoy the scenic beauty as the milky white water cascades down the lush green mountains. Take a refreshing dip in the natural pool formed by the waterfall or simply relax and capture beautiful photographs. (Entrance fee: INR 400 per person, 3 hours)
